Answered step by step
Verified Expert Solution
Link Copied!

Question

1 Approved Answer

Give your most conscise answer to the following questions: What is a data structure and abstract data type (ADT)? Rules of recursion, what is required?

Give your most conscise answer to the following questions:

What is a data structure and abstract data type (ADT)?

Rules of recursion, what is required? How does it work--explain program stack

Why do we analyze algorithms?

- How do we classify runtime/space usage of an algorithm?

- What's Big-Oh, Big-Omega, Big-Theta and little-oh?

- Given funciton or piece of code, give its Big-Oh, Big-Omega, Big-Theta and little-oh classification

- what is meant by order of growth for functions (...,linear, quadratic, cubic,...)

- What is the Binary Search algorithm and what are its preconditions?

-- what data structure is required for the Binary Search algorithm and why?

- In general, give runtime analysis of various algorithms discussed in class or homework,

and runtimes for operations performed on data structures and abstract data types.

Step by Step Solution

There are 3 Steps involved in it

Step: 1

blur-text-image

Get Instant Access to Expert-Tailored Solutions

See step-by-step solutions with expert insights and AI powered tools for academic success

Step: 2

blur-text-image

Step: 3

blur-text-image

Ace Your Homework with AI

Get the answers you need in no time with our AI-driven, step-by-step assistance

Get Started

Recommended Textbook for

Essentials of Database Management

Authors: Jeffrey A. Hoffer, Heikki Topi, Ramesh Venkataraman

1st edition

133405680, 9780133547702 , 978-0133405682

More Books

Students also viewed these Databases questions